Job description
  • West Suffolk College Sites - Cambridgeshire
  • 21 hours per week, 52 weeks per year, Permanent
  • Salary: £27,612 - £39,173 per annum (Actual Salary: £16,613 - £23,568 per annum)
We are seeking an individual with the necessary skills and knowledge to inspire and engage adults in the classroom, who demonstrates sound organisational, administrative and IT skills, with a genuine commitment to student development and learning.

This role will play an active part within the ESOL team, teaching a range of classes across our college, learning centres and workplaces to include (but not limited to:) Chatteris, Ely, Newmarket and Soham. The successful candidate should have experience in teaching ESOL and working with young adults. A Level 5 ESOL qualification such as CELTA is essential to the role.

West Suffolk College is one of the country's leading further education and apprenticeship providers. Our apprenticeship results have consistently remained above the national average. We offer many degrees, HNCs and HNDs at our focused and inclusive University Studies Centre . We have around 13,000 students including nearly 2,000 apprentices studying with us.
